danrekshan Posted October 5, 2009 Posted October 5, 2009 I have a problem using Google Checkout as sole method of payment and its calculating sales tax. Absolutely everything else is working except that Google Checkout will not calculate state-based sales tax. Its www.danielsimagination.com/store Here's my set up: OsCommerce 2.2 Google Checkout 1.5 GC is the sole method of payment and I don't collect any personal information in OSC. In GC, I have a tax set up for California. I've tried putting the product in a tax class. Then, I've deleted all the tax classes in admin, so the products don't have any tax information I've tested checking-out in both Sandbox and Production, but it always yields 0.00 for sales tax. While I am at the end of my skill here, I suspect that OSC is not sending a descriptor in the product details to GC that would trigger Google's tax setup. Any help would be much appreciated!
